Quick Caramel Corn

Preserved from 75 Years of Caring and Sharing, printed page 276.

Ingredients

  • 1 (6 oz.) pkg. butterscotch chips
  • ½ c. light or dark corn syrup
  • 5 c. popped corn

Instructions

  • Mix together butterscotch chips and corn syrup in double boiler. Heat over boiling water until butterscotch chips are melted. Stir to blend well.
  • Pour over popped corn. Stir until well coated.
  • Spread in a lightly greased 9x9x2 inch pan. Cool and cut into squares.

Notes

Source note: Makes 16 (2½ inch) squares.
